What is overspeed protection and how does it operate?

Explanation:
Overspeed protection is a safety function that watches the turbine’s rotor speed and prevents it from exceeding the maximum safe speed. It uses sensors to monitor RPM, and when the speed reaches or surpasses the preset limit, it acts quickly to protect the machine. The typical action is to reduce or cut fuel flow, or to trip the engine so it shuts down, bringing the speed back down before the rotating parts suffer damage. This protection is essential because overspeed can cause blade and bearing damage, rotor instability, and other catastrophic failures. It’s different from temperature control or a normal speed governor. Temperature protection handles high exhaust gas temperatures, not speed itself, and a governor tries to hold a target RPM under normal loading. Overspeed protection serves as a backup safety mechanism that intervenes when control systems fail or abnormal conditions push speed beyond safe limits. It does not work by increasing fuel; that would drive the speed higher and worsen the risk.
